fbdev: remove I2C_CLASS_DDC support
After removal of the legacy EEPROM driver and I2C_CLASS_DDC support in olpc_dcon there's no i2c client driver left supporting I2C_CLASS_DDC. Class-based device auto-detection is a legacy mechanism and shouldn't be used in new code. So we can remove this class completely now.
